 QFC says it acted appropriately in beef recall
The suit alleges QFC negligently sold the meat and did not appropriately notify the family -- and potentially hundreds of others who bought and ate beef from a batch that was ultimately recalled and linked to a slaughtered Yakima Valley Holstein.
In her suit, Crowson contends that QFC had the "means and ability" to contact her and other customers who unwittingly bought the beef by tracking purchases through QFC Advantage Cards.
Crowson's suit claims QFC neglected to do that -- at least not until after she learned through a news story in January that QFC had carried the beef, and then called the company on her own to have her purchases traced.

 komo news | Lawsuit Against QFC Allowed To Continue
Crowson maintains QFC was negligent about warning consumers, especially in light of the QFC Advantage Card which tracks not only her purchases but her name, address and phone number.
Because of that card, Crowson says QFC was negligent, in not warning her as soon as the store knew.
While allowing Crowson's claim that QFC was liable because of the store's role as a product seller, Judge William Downing granted QFC's motion to dismiss Crowson's two other claims that QFC was liable as a product manufacturer because it ground the potentially tainted meat from its supplier.

The QFC Law (Law No. 7 of 2005) was signed by the Emir of the State of Qatar on 9 March 2005 and became effective on 1 May 2005.
The QFC Law provides for the basic construction of the QFC and establishes the QFC Authority, the QFC Regulatory Authority and the Appeals Body.
The QFC Financial Services Regulations (FSR), enacted under the QFC Law, are the primary Regulations which define the management, objectives, duties, functions, powers and constitution of the QFC Regulatory Authority.
